With the Bavarian Easter holidays beginning on March 27th, the summer flight schedule at Nuremberg Airport will commence – and Corendon Airlines will launch with a second aircraft. Travelers from the metropolitan region will benefit from an even wider selection of sunny destinations and more connections.
The second aircraft of the leisure airline based in Nuremberg provides additional capacity and greater flexibility in the tightly scheduled summer flight plan. This deployment marks another milestone in the long-standing partnership between the airline, the airport, and the city of Nuremberg, and creates additional jobs and regional economic benefits.
Diverse summer offer: 14 popular sun destinations nonstop
For summer 2026, Corendon Airlines will offer one of the most comprehensive tourist programs from Nuremberg in recent years. Corendon’s summer destinations include Hurghada in Egypt, the Greek islands of Corfu, Kos, Heraklion in Crete, and Rhodes, as well as Mallorca, Fuerteventura, and Gran Canaria. Fuerteventura will now also be served in the summer with up to three weekly flights. In addition, Antalya, Izmir, Kayseri, and Adana in Turkey will be included. Corendon Airlines will thus serve both classic beach destinations and important connections to Turkey, providing a vital link to home for many families in the region.
Onboard catering concept: Cooperation with football star Lukas Podolski
A highlight at the start of the season is the cooperation between Corendon Airlines and “Mangal Döner”, the gastronomic concept of football star Lukas Podolski and professional chef Metin Dag. Since February 2026, the airline has been offering new in-flight products such as lahmacun, a popular Turkish street food dish, on selected routes.

Strong start to the holidays
At the start of the holiday season, the airport expects around 250,000 passengers, who will have a choice of over 60 nonstop destinations. About Corendon Airlines
Corendon Airlines (Antalya, Turkey) is an international airline with sister companies Corendon Dutch (Amsterdam, Netherlands) and Corendon Europe (Malta). Corendon Airlines flies from numerous airports in Germany, Austria, and Switzerland to popular holiday destinations in the Mediterranean – such as Turkey, Spain, Greece, and Egypt – as well as the Canary Islands. The airline also works closely with tour operators and travel agencies.
Corendon Airlines was founded in 2004 as part of the Corendon Group, a multinational tourism group that started operations in the Netherlands in 2000 and which today includes airlines, tour operators, hotels and incoming agencies.
Since its first flight in 2005, Corendon Airlines has followed the motto “Make a Difference” and distinguished itself through innovation and customer service. Among other achievements, Corendon Airlines was the first airline in Europe to be certified according to ISO 10002 for its customer satisfaction management system.
